Randy Feenstra, U.S. Congressman representing Iowa’s 4th district since 2021, highlighted key policy priorities in a series of social media posts on September 10, 2025. The tweets addressed tax policy, rural economic development, and agricultural advocacy.

On September 10, Feenstra posted about recent changes to the child tax credit under the Trump administration: “President Trump’s Working Families Tax Cuts increase the child tax credit to $2,200 and make it permanent. That means parents have more money in their pockets to raise their children.”

Later that day, he shared details from a meeting with local business leaders: “I enjoyed sitting down with my neighbors from the Sioux Center Chamber of Commerce to talk about how we can grow our rural communities and strengthen our economy. We also discussed how the Working Families Tax Cuts will be jet fuel for our economy and invest in our main streets.”

Feenstra also commented on agricultural issues following a discussion with industry representatives: “I had a great time chatting with @IowaPork about getting a new Farm Bill signed into law, opening new export markets for Iowa pork, and holding California accountable for its attacks on Iowa agriculture. I’ll keep working to support our hog farmers and defend rural Iowa!”

Feenstra has served as the representative for Iowa’s 4th congressional district since defeating Steve King in 2020. He previously held office in the Iowa Senate from 2009 until his election to Congress. Born in Hull, Iowa in 1969 and an alumnus of Dordt University (BA, 1991), Feenstra continues to reside in Hull while focusing on issues relevant to his constituents.
